位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el百科 > 文章详情

怎么合并两个excel数据

作者:excel百科网
|
94人看过
发布时间:2026-01-19 09:40:54
标签:
如何高效合并两个Excel数据表:实用方法与深度解析在数据处理中,Excel作为最常用的工具之一,常常需要将多个数据表进行整合。无论是财务报表、销售数据,还是用户行为分析,合并两个Excel表格是日常工作中常见的操作。合理利用Exce
怎么合并两个excel数据
如何高效合并两个Excel数据表:实用方法与深度解析
在数据处理中,Excel作为最常用的工具之一,常常需要将多个数据表进行整合。无论是财务报表、销售数据,还是用户行为分析,合并两个Excel表格是日常工作中常见的操作。合理利用Excel的功能,不仅能提升工作效率,还能避免数据重复或遗漏。本文将从多个角度,系统讲解如何高效、安全地合并两个Excel数据表,并提供实用技巧。
一、合并Excel数据的基本概念
合并两个Excel数据表,是指将两个独立的表格内容进行整合,形成一个统一的数据集合。合并的方式包括横向合并(行合并)和纵向合并(列合并),具体取决于数据的结构和需求。
在Excel中,合并两个表格通常涉及以下步骤:
1. 打开两个Excel文件:确保两个文件都已打开,并且数据表结构清晰。
2. 选择数据范围:确定要合并的数据区域,包括起始行和结束行。
3. 使用Excel内置功能:通过“数据”菜单中的“合并表”功能,将两个表格整合成一个。
4. 调整数据格式:根据需要,对合并后的数据进行格式调整,如合并单元格、调整列宽等。
5. 保存文件:完成合并后,保存修改后的文件。
二、合并两个Excel数据表的常见方法
1. 使用“数据”菜单中的“合并表”功能
这是最常用、最直接的方法,适用于两个数据表结构相似的情况。
步骤说明:
- 打开Excel,选择要合并的两个表格。
- 点击菜单栏中的“数据” → “合并表”。
- 在弹出的对话框中,选择要合并的源数据范围。
- 设置合并方式(行合并或列合并)。
- 点击“确定”即可完成合并。
优点:
- 操作简单,适合结构一致的表格。
- 支持多种合并方式,灵活度高。
注意事项:
- 确保两个数据表的列数和行数一致,否则合并后可能产生错误。
- 若数据量较大,建议使用“数据透视表”或“Power Query”进行更高效的数据处理。
2. 使用Power Query进行数据合并
Power Query是Excel中强大的数据处理工具,尤其适合处理复杂的数据集。
步骤说明:
- 打开Excel,点击“数据” → “获取数据” → “从其他源” → “从Excel”。
- 选择要合并的两个Excel文件,点击“加载到查询”。
- 在Power Query编辑器中,选择两个查询,点击“合并查询”。
- 设置合并条件(如按列名或行号合并)。
- 点击“关闭并继续”保存合并后的数据。
优点:
- 操作流程清晰,适合复杂数据处理。
- 支持多条件合并,可实现更精准的数据整合。
注意事项:
- 合并前需确保两个数据表的结构一致。
- 合并后可对数据进行筛选、排序、分组等操作。
3. 使用VBA宏实现自动化合并
对于需要频繁合并数据的用户,使用VBA宏可以实现自动化操作,提高效率。
步骤说明:
- 按快捷键 `ALT + F11` 打开VBA编辑器。
- 插入模块,编写合并数据的VBA代码。
- 调试并运行代码,完成数据合并。
优点:
- 自动化程度高,适合大量数据处理。
- 可定制化操作,灵活度高。
注意事项:
- 编写VBA代码需具备一定的编程基础。
- 需注意代码的稳定性与安全性。
三、合并数据时的注意事项与技巧
1. 数据一致性检查
在合并数据前,务必检查两个数据表的结构是否一致,包括列名、数据类型、数据范围等。
实践建议:
- 使用Excel的“数据透视表”功能,对比两个数据表的结构。
- 若数据表有重复列或不同列,需在合并前进行清洗。
2. 避免数据冲突
合并数据时,可能会出现数据重复或冲突,需注意处理。
实践建议:
- 在合并前,使用“删除重复项”功能,剔除重复数据。
- 若数据表中存在空值或错误值,需先进行数据清洗。
3. 格式与数据类型匹配
合并后的数据格式应与原始数据一致,避免因格式不一致导致后续处理困难。
实践建议:
- 合并前,确保两个数据表的列宽、字体、字体颜色等格式一致。
- 若数据类型不一致(如文本与数字混用),需进行类型转换。
四、合并数据后的数据处理与优化
合并数据后,通常还需要进行后续的处理,如筛选、排序、分组等,以满足具体需求。
1. 数据筛选
筛选是合并数据后常见的操作,用于提取特定数据范围。
实践建议:
- 使用“筛选”功能,按列名或值进行筛选。
- 可结合“数据透视表”进行多条件筛选。
2. 数据排序
排序是根据数据的数值或文本进行排列,便于分析。
实践建议:
- 使用“排序”功能,按列名或数值排序。
- 可结合“数据透视表”进行多条件排序。
3. 数据分组
分组是将数据按某一列或条件进行分类,便于统计分析。
实践建议:
- 使用“分组”功能,按列名或数值分组。
- 可结合“数据透视表”进行多条件分组。
五、合并数据的常见误区与解决方法
1. 合并后数据不一致
原因:
- 两个数据表结构不一致,列名、数据类型不匹配。
解决方法:
- 合并前进行数据清洗,确保结构一致。
- 使用“数据透视表”进行对比分析。
2. 合并后数据重复
原因:
- 合并时未设置唯一标识,导致数据重复。
解决方法:
- 在合并前添加唯一标识列(如ID),确保数据唯一。
- 使用“删除重复项”功能,剔除重复数据。
3. 合并后数据格式混乱
原因:
- 合并时未注意格式设置,导致数据混乱。
解决方法:
- 在合并前确保格式一致,如列宽、字体、字体颜色等。
- 使用“数据透视表”进行格式调整。
六、总结与建议
合并两个Excel数据表是日常数据处理中不可或缺的一环。通过合理选择合并方法,如“数据”菜单中的“合并表”、Power Query、VBA宏等,可以高效完成数据整合。同时,合并前需注意数据一致性、格式匹配和数据清洗,确保合并后的数据准确无误。
对于数据量较大或结构复杂的用户,建议使用Power Query进行自动化处理,提升效率。对于需要高度定制化的用户,VBA宏是理想选择。无论采用哪种方法,都应注重数据的准确性和完整性。
在实际工作中,建议结合自身需求选择最合适的合并方法,并不断优化数据处理流程,以实现更高效的数据管理与分析。
七、深度解析:合并数据的底层原理
在Excel中,合并两个数据表本质上是通过Excel的“数据”功能,实现两个数据集的整合。其底层原理涉及Excel的数据结构、数据类型以及合并操作的逻辑。
1. Excel的数据结构
Excel中的数据以行和列的形式存储,每一行代表一条记录,每一列代表一个字段。合并两个数据表,本质上是将两个数据集的行和列进行组合,形成一个统一的数据集合。
2. 合并操作的逻辑
合并操作是Excel的“数据”功能中的一部分,其逻辑包括:
- 行合并:将两个数据集的行进行合并,形成新的行。
- 列合并:将两个数据集的列进行合并,形成新的列。
- 条件合并:根据特定条件(如列名、数值)进行合并。
3. 数据合并的性能影响
合并操作的性能取决于数据量和合并方式。对于大量数据,推荐使用Power Query进行自动化处理,避免直接使用“合并表”功能带来的性能瓶颈。
八、未来趋势与技术发展
随着数据处理技术的不断进步,Excel在数据合并方面也逐步向自动化、智能化方向发展。未来,结合人工智能和机器学习技术,Excel可能会提供更智能的数据合并功能,如自动识别数据结构、智能填充缺失值、自动筛选条件等。
对于用户而言,掌握多种数据合并方法,不仅能提高工作效率,还能更好地应对复杂的数据处理需求。
九、
合并两个Excel数据表是数据处理中的基础技能,掌握多种方法,不仅能提升工作效率,还能确保数据的准确性与完整性。在实际工作中,建议根据具体需求选择合适的工具和方法,不断优化数据处理流程,以实现更高效的管理工作。
推荐文章
相关文章
推荐URL
如何将PDF中的数据复制到Excel:全面指南与实用技巧PDF文件在现代办公和数据处理中非常常见,尤其在需要共享和编辑文档时。然而,PDF文件通常以静态格式存在,数据格式不统一,难以直接复制到Excel中。本文将详细介绍如何将PDF中
2026-01-19 09:37:55
299人看过
大一计算机考试Excel题解析与实战技巧 一、Excel的起源与基本功能Excel是由微软公司开发的一种电子表格软件,自1985年推出以来,已经成为全球范围内广泛使用的办公软件之一。Excel的主要功能包括数据输入、计算、图表制作
2026-01-19 09:37:55
104人看过
排列在Excel中的应用:从基础到高级Excel作为一款功能强大的电子表格软件,其核心功能之一便是对数据进行排序、筛选、计算和排列。排列功能是Excel中一项非常实用的工具,它可以帮助用户对数据进行组织、整理和展示,从而提升工作效率。
2026-01-19 09:37:47
200人看过
打印顺丰快递单模板Excel:从基础到进阶的实用指南在日常生活中,快递已成为我们日常生活中不可或缺的一部分。无论是日常购物、办公需求,还是紧急的物流配送,快递单据都扮演着重要的角色。而顺丰快递单据作为快递服务的重要组成部分,其格式和内
2026-01-19 09:37:41
289人看过
热门推荐
热门专题:
资讯中心: